Job Description

At Houston Methodist the Director Education and Clinical Support position is responsible for providing strategic direction and operations that advance the delivery of patient care education research and professional practice. This position fosters a continuous learning environment through periodic needs assessment development implementation evaluation and revision based on outcomes of high quality innovative and timely educational programs that further the leadership and science of nursing for professional and nonprofessional staff and patients. The Director Education and Clinical Support position oversees clinical competency orientation professional development of clinical staff compliance and professional excellence through ongoing Magnet and DNV standard compliance. This position leads evidencebased practice initiatives and coordinates nursing research protocols studies and outcome dissemination. The Director Education and Clinical Support position may oversee other clinical support areas. This position also coordinates agreements and clinical affiliations with university schools of nursing.

The Director position responsibilities include overseeing the activities of the department staff ensuring quality productivity functional excellence and efficiency to accomplish strategic and operational objectives. In addition this position is accountable for employee engagement adequate staffing levels budget development and compliance staffing decisions such as hiring and terminating employment coaching and counseling employees on work related performance and developing and implementing policies and procedures to ensure a safe and effective work environment. This position also ensures training monitoring and operations initiatives are implemented which secure compliance with ethical and legal business practices and accreditation/regulatory/government regulations.

EDUCATION
  • Bachelors and Masters degree one which must be from an accredited School of Nursing
  • Doctorate preferred

WORK EXPERIENCE
  • Three years leadership experience preferably in an education setting; for internal incumbents two years leadership experience with HM performance that demonstrates progressive abilities
  • Five years experience in education or staff development
LICENSES AND CERTIFICATIONS REQUIRED
  • RN Registered Nurse Texas State Licensure and/or Compact State Licensure within 60 days OR
  • RNTemp Registered Nurse Temporary State Licensure within 60 days AND
  • BLS Basic Life Support (AHA) AND
  • MagnetL ANCC Recognized Leadership Certification within 6 months

LICENSES AND CERTIFICATIONS PREFERRED
  • ACLS Advanced Cardiac Life Support (AHA)

Company Profile:

Houston Methodist Clear Lake Hospital is committed to leading medicine in Clear Lake and surrounding communities by delivering the Houston Methodist standard of exceptional safety quality service and innovation. Houston Methodist Clear Lake provides a broad spectrum of adult pediatric medical and surgical care. It is an accredited chest pain center and acute strokeready designated through DNV. Houston Methodist Clear Lake offers advanced inpatient and outpatient services including stateoftheart imaging; childbirth center with a level II neonatal intensive care unit; minimally invasive surgery; cancer center; neurology and spine care; heart and vascular care; bariatric and digestive care; emergency care; primary care; rehabilitation services; and comprehensive orthopedics and sports medicine.
